August 29, 2006 —
River levels are being monitored closely as water rushes into the Rio Grande.
Sunland Park, NM police and fire departments are standing by in case flooding occurs.
The serene Rio Grande that area residents are used to has turned into a raging river.
"Right now it looks like it's getting overflowed again like two weeks ago," said Mando Marquez, a Sunland Park resident.
For a lot of people, watching the swollen river is a spectacle. But to others, it's a big worry.
Homes in Sunland Park are dangerously close to the river. Residents fear if the river overflows they might have to evacuate once again.
"That's how come they evacuated us, a lot of water was coming in. It damaged the levy," said Abel Saenz, a Sunland Park resident.
Saenz, like a lot of residents has the river for a back yard. The site of the Rio Grande today is enough to worry residents.
"Try to get as many things out, our valuables and stuff out of there," said Philip Gonzalez.
The river water has come close enough to their homes before and these residents here are not going to take any chances.
"I usually have other places to stay, but they'll evacuate us and take us to another place like the middle school," said Saenz.
City officials expect the levy system to protect residents. But other precautions are in place. They are monitoring the back flow of the drainage ditches that flow into the Rio Grande. The city has two pumps in low-lying areas to pump the water out in case it gets too close to the levy. They also have a supply of sandbags ready to distribute.
